Start Watch Mode

Start watch mode for a library to automatically detect and process new/modified files. Supports ebook, manga, and comic libraries with real-time file system monitoring.

Endpoint: POST /api/scanner/watch/start Auth: Required (Admin only) Content-Type: application/json

Request Body

Field Type Required Description
library_id string (UUID) Yes Library UUID to watch (supports ebooks, manga, and comics)

Watch Mode Features

Watch mode automatically detects and processes:

  • New files added to library folders
  • Modified files that have been updated
  • Format-specific metadata extraction for comics (.cbz, .cbr) and manga
  • ComicInfo.xml parsing for comic archives
  • Image-based manga processing for individual page files

Example Request

{
  "library_id": "550e8400-e29b-41d4-a716-446655440000"
}

Response (200 OK)

{
  "message": "Watch mode started successfully",
  "library_id": "uuid",
  "status": "watching"
}

Error Responses

Code Description
400 Invalid request data
401 Invalid or expired token
403 User does not have admin privileges
404 Library not found
409 Watch mode already active for this library
